Reseña del editor

Shady dealings, government corruption, and the ruthless pursuit of money and power: It's politics as usual in The Corrupt Republic, the explosive new political thriller by Andrew Buck.Inspired by Americans' growing distrust of Wall Street and Washington, The Corrupt Republic tells the all-too-believable story of one man's entry into the upper echelons of power and politics, the shocking corruption he uncovers and the lengths to which those with the most to lose will go to keep him from talking.The book's release is timely, given America's disillusionment -- Democrats, Republicans and Independents alike -- with politicians and disgust with the financial crisis. The novel's vision drew from the nation's political divisions and the despair people felt in the face of obvious political corruption, crippling financial bailouts, "tea party" revolts, record deficit spending, a deep recession and the desire for meaningful change in Washington.Ultimately, the novel also shines a light into that darkness by introducing a main character that reflects the best of America and exemplifies the nation's ethical core and values. Readers will walk away from The Corrupt Republic with a new resolve against the marriage of business and politics and renewed hope for the future of the country.Buck is not the likely choice to write a page-turner about dirty dealings in Washington, but as he watched the rapidly changing political and financial landscape of America, he couldn't shake the idea for The Corrupt Republic. The novel quickly took shape."Because of our current political and economic situation, and the current American mood, The Corrupt Republic lays the foundation for a compelling dialogue on the future direction of our country," said Buck. "It provides a present-day perspective to help readers understand how critical political and financial decisions affect our nation's future."
